      Jimmy takes his hat off when he asks if John is working again. That shows he's not asking as an officer, but for himself. Obviously he's aware of what John has done for a living, but also knows John isn't a danger to anyone outside the underworld of crime. He has no intention to arrest John (which he realizes would be futile), but merely wants to be aware to stay out of any lines of fire and let John be. And John respects Jimmy, knowing he's just doing his job, and since he understands Jimmy is not going to impede him, bids him a good night.
      That scene is a masterpiece of mutual understanding and respect.

    There's a fun fact about this movie that people who actually speak Russian find hillarious. You see, Baba Yaga is not really a Boogieman. The part "baba" actually means "old lady". And Baba Yaga is a character from Slavic folklore. It's an ancient witch that lives deep into the forrest in a hut on chicken legs. However, there's another character in Russian and Slavic folklore who is called "Babayka". And Babayka is like this spirit, or some sort of spiritual entity. He comes for kids who misbehave and snatches them. The word comes from "babay" wich means "old man" in the Tatar language. The fact that this spirit has no description plays on the imagination of kids making him even more terrifying. That being said, I believe the creators of John WIck probably meant to make John a Babayka rather than Baba Yaga. But.. oh, well. We got what we got.

    Even if Marcus had been planning to kill John, he couldn't have taken that shot at the hotel. The Continental is essentially "neutral ground" and everyone on the property is protected. What matters is if the target is on the property, not whether the attacker is. So even though Marcus wasn't in the hotel, he still would've been breaking the rule.
    Ironically, that means the safest, cleanest, most comfortable hotels on the planet...are run by the criminal underworld. And because they're meant to operate as a legitimate front, they also allow normal people to stay there. So someone could actually take their wife and kids on a vacation, and unknowingly stay in a really great hotel filled with assassins and possibly worse...and be safer there than literally anywhere else on the entire planet.
    That whole notion is just awesome, and hilarious. And yet, when you really think about it, it makes so much sense. They'd NEED rules like that, or their whole web of organizations would just fall apart. It's really genius, honestly.
